Hakim Ziyech to Chelsea

Primary Position – Right Wing

Other position(s) – Left Wing / Attacking Midfielder

Last two seasons’ form – Games 50 / Goals 22 / Assists 30

Born in March of 1993 in the Netherlands, Ziyech started out at the Reaal Dronten and ASV Dronten academies before joining Heerenveen in 2007. He made his Eredevisie debut for the club in the 2012/13 season and scored 11 goals over 36 league appearances. He was signed by Twente ahead of the 2014/15 season for €3.5m. He went on to register 13 goals and 15 assists in the 2014/15 campaign over 33 league appearances. He further improved on these numbers in the 2015/16 season, notching 17 goals and 12 assists over 33 league appearances. Ajax signed him in August 2016 for €11m. His output dipped in his first season with the Dutch giants with nine goals and 13 assists over 32 league appearances. The 2017/18 season was similar with nine goals and 17 assists over 34 league matches. The 2018/19 season was where he really came into his own. He registered 16 goals and 17 assists in 29 league matches as well as notching three goals and three assists in 11 Champions League appearances, playing predominantly on the right-wing. He missed nine games through injury in the 2019/20 season but still managed six goals and 13 assists in 21 league matches. Eligible to play for either Netherlands or Morocco, he chose the latter and scored 14 goals over 32 international appearances. Ziyech featured in the Eredivise Team of the year three times and was also voted Ajax player of the year for the 2017/18, 2018/19 and 2019/20 seasons.

Chelsea have bought one of the most coveted talents in Europe. Renowned for his set piece prowess, he is likely to take over free-kick and corner duties for the London side. He can play in any position across the front three but it is likely that Lampard will opt to use him in his preferred position, on the right wing. 82 assists for Ajax over 165 matches is an impressive number which highlights the creativity he will provide for the likes of Werner and Pulisic. Besides the calf problem which caused him to miss eight matches in the 2019/20 campaign, he has been largely injury free over his career, making an average of 30 league appearances in every campaign prior to 2019/20. He can be expected to nail down the right wing role for Lampard’s side at the expense of Willian and his penchant for goals and assists should make him an enticing Fantasy Premier League (FPL) prospect.
